1. We Have Band – Modulate

Produced and directed by Rod Solab Huart, We Have Band’s latest music video is a 90’s inspired story between fantasy and reality starring two guys on motorbikes, a girl, betrayal and wet T-shirts.

2. OK Go – The Writing’s On The Wall

OK Go is one of those bands with an impressive collection of original videos. This one’s filled with camera tricks and almost feels as if the song was purely written with this in mind.

3. Lana Del Rey – Shades Of Cool

Lana Del Rey’s new album ‘Ultraviolence’ is a world-building record that leaves us wondering about the divide between reality and fiction. The video for ‘Shades Of Cool’ is more fairy tale than it sounds and depicts a romantic fling with an older man – immersed in the mirage-like American iconography that has coloured her music since ‘Video Games’.
